The latest officially reported population of Djibouti was 1,168,722 in 2024 vs 5,805,962 people in Lebanon in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Djibouti's population is 1,199,623 people compared to 5,898,001 in Lebanon.
Population statistics:
- Lebanon's population is 4.92 times bigger than Djibouti's.
- Djibouti is ranked the 158th most populous country in the world, while Lebanon is the 115th.
- The countries together account for 0.09% of the world: 0.01% for Djibouti vs 0.07% for Lebanon.
- For the last 10 years, Djibouti has had an average growth rate of +1.57% per year vs +0.16% in Lebanon.
- Since 2006, the population of Djibouti has increased from 856K people to 1.2M (40.2% growth), while Lebanon has grown from 4.75M to 5.9M (24.1% growth).
- Djibouti is projected to reach its peak in 2100 at 1.84M people compared to the peak of 7.46M people in 2080 for Lebanon.

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Djibouti increased by 181,889 people (a 21.3% growth), while Lebanon gained 1,571,924 people (a 33.1% growth).
For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Djibouti gained 161,970 (a 15.6% growth), while Lebanon's population decreased by -425,059 (a 6.72% decline).
Djibouti was ranked 159th most populous country in 2006 and is 158th in 2026. Lebanon was ranked 115th in 2006 and still ranked 115th now.
The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that with changing growth rate trends in 24 years (in 2050) Djibouti's population will grow by 27.6% to 1,530,539 people with a rank change from 158th to 151st. The population of Lebanon will increase by 18.7% to 6,999,259 people and will still be ranked 115th.
